Its interrupting capacity reaches 220 kA at 240 V, 154 kA at 415 V, and 75.6 kA at 440 V — figures that place it in the high-fault category for industrial distribution and motor control centers where fault currents exceed standard MCCB ratings. 3-pole design, 800 V rated insulation voltage.
At 40 °C the breaker carries the full 200 A; derate to 194 A at 55 °C, 188 A at 60 °C, 182 A at 65 °C, and 176 A at 70 °C — a straight thermal curve that lets the panel designer size the enclosure ventilation against the load current without guessing.
Undervoltage release and trip unit detail
Factory-fitted undervoltage release (UVR) trips when control voltage drops below threshold.
